VPN Connection Troubleshooting Guide: Solving Common Issues from DNS Leaks to Protocol Incompatibility

4/30/2026 · 3 min

1. DNS Leak Issues

A DNS leak occurs when the VPN fails to route DNS queries correctly, exposing your real DNS requests to your ISP or third parties. This severely compromises privacy.

1.1 Detecting DNS Leaks

  • Visit DNS leak test websites such as ipleak.net or dnsleaktest.com.
  • Refresh the page after connecting to the VPN and check whether the displayed DNS servers belong to your VPN provider.
  • If your ISP's DNS servers appear, a leak exists.

1.2 Solutions

  • Enable VPN's built-in DNS leak protection: Most modern VPN clients offer this option; manually enable it in settings.
  • Manually configure DNS: Change system network settings to use public DNS like 1.1.1.1 or 8.8.8.8.
  • Use VPN's dedicated DNS: Some VPN services provide exclusive DNS addresses that effectively prevent leaks.
  • Disable IPv6: If your VPN does not support IPv6, disable the IPv6 protocol in system network settings.

2. Protocol Incompatibility

VPN protocols (e.g., OpenVPN, WireGuard, IKEv2) may be incompatible with network environments (e.g., firewalls, NAT), causing connection failures or frequent drops.

2.1 Common Symptoms

  • Connection timeout or stuck in "connecting" state.
  • Immediate disconnection after connecting.
  • Inability to connect on specific networks (e.g., public Wi-Fi, corporate networks).

2.2 Troubleshooting Steps

  1. Switch protocol: Try different protocols in the VPN client (e.g., from OpenVPN to WireGuard or IKEv2).
  2. Change port: Some networks block common VPN ports (e.g., 1194 UDP); try using 443 TCP or a custom port.
  3. Use obfuscation or stealth: Some VPNs offer obfuscation options (e.g., OpenVPN over SSL) to bypass deep packet inspection (DPI).
  4. Check firewall settings: Temporarily disable the firewall or add an exception rule for the VPN application.

3. Speed Degradation

VPN encryption and routing introduce extra latency, but abnormally slow speeds may result from misconfiguration or server overload.

3.1 Optimization Methods

  • Select nearest or low-load servers: Prioritize servers that are geographically close and have low load.
  • Change protocol: WireGuard is generally faster than OpenVPN and suitable for speed-sensitive scenarios.
  • Adjust encryption strength: Within security limits, choose lower encryption (e.g., AES-128-GCM instead of AES-256-GCM).
  • Enable multi-threading: Some VPN clients support multi-threading to improve throughput.

4. Frequent Connection Drops

Unstable VPN connections can be caused by network fluctuations, client software issues, or server-side limitations.

4.1 Diagnosis and Fixes

  • Update VPN client: Ensure you are using the latest version to fix known bugs.
  • Adjust timeout settings: Increase connection timeout and retry intervals.
  • Enable auto-reconnect: Most clients support automatic reconnection on disconnection.
  • Change network environment: Try switching from Wi-Fi to mobile data to rule out local network issues.
  • Contact VPN support: If the problem persists, it may be a server-side fault; contact the provider.

5. Conclusion

VPN connection issues usually stem from DNS configuration, protocol selection, or network environment limitations. Through systematic troubleshooting and targeted adjustments, most problems can be quickly resolved. It is recommended that users regularly update their clients, test for DNS leaks, and flexibly switch protocols based on the network environment to ensure stable connections and privacy security.

Related reading

Related articles

VPN Health Diagnostic Manual: Identifying, Locating, and Fixing Common Connection Issues
This article provides a comprehensive VPN health diagnostic guide, helping users systematically identify, locate, and fix common VPN connection issues. Covering everything from basic checks to advanced diagnostics, including network settings, protocol configuration, server status, and client problems, it aims to restore stable and secure connections.
Read more
VPN Traffic Hijacking Risks: From DNS Leaks to TLS Stripping Attacks
This article provides an in-depth analysis of common VPN traffic hijacking risks, including DNS leaks and TLS stripping attacks, along with corresponding protection recommendations.
Read more
Common Pitfalls in VPN Deployment: DNS Leaks, Routing Conflicts, and Log Management
This article delves into three common pitfalls in VPN deployment: DNS leaks compromising privacy, routing conflicts causing network outages, and improper log management leading to compliance risks, along with systematic solutions.
Read more
VPN Security Hardening Guide: Configuration Strategies to Prevent DNS Leaks and Traffic Hijacking
This article provides a comprehensive guide to identifying and mitigating DNS leaks and traffic hijacking risks in VPN setups, covering DNS configuration, firewall rules, protocol selection, and testing methodologies for enhanced security.
Read more
2026 VPN Security Review: Which Services Are Leaking Your Data?
The 2026 VPN security review reveals data leakage risks in mainstream VPN services, including DNS leaks, WebRTC leaks, and logging issues. Based on independent test data, this article analyzes which services truly protect user privacy and which pose security risks.
Read more
From Lag to Smoothness: Root Cause Analysis and Systematic Solutions for VPN Stability Issues
This article delves into the root causes of VPN instability, including network infrastructure, protocol selection, and server load, and provides systematic optimization solutions to help users achieve a smooth experience.
Read more

FAQ

How can I quickly detect a DNS leak in my VPN?
After connecting to the VPN, visit a DNS leak test site like ipleak.net or dnsleaktest.com. If your ISP's DNS servers appear, a leak exists.
What should I do if my VPN connection keeps dropping?
First, update your VPN client to the latest version. Then try switching protocols or ports. Enable auto-reconnect and check firewall settings. If the issue persists, change your network environment or contact VPN support.
Why is my VPN connection very slow?
Slow speeds can be caused by high server load, improper protocol selection, or excessive encryption strength. Connect to a nearby low-load server, try WireGuard protocol, and consider lowering encryption strength.
Read more